Dealing with ghosts: Managing the user experience of autonomic computing
نویسندگان
چکیده
Although the goal of autonomic computing is to make systems that work continuously, robustly, and simply, no one imagines that people can be excluded entirely. Whether it is end users getting their jobs done by interacting with autonomic systems or system administrators maintaining, monitoring, and debugging large-scale systems with autonomic components, humans will always be part of the computational process. As autonomic systems become part of the computing infrastructure, new demands will be placed on all users. How do users understand what autonomic systems are trying to do? How should systems portray themselves to users? How can we design the experience of autonomic computing to amplify user capabilities? This paper presents an analysis of the user experience challenges of autonomic computing and discusses design requirements for user interaction. Our main point is that autonomic computing makes effective design of the user experience even more challenging and critical than it is now. The reason is that autonomic actions taken by the system must be understandable by the user and capable of review, revision, and alteration. Because such actions are often made autonomously, a heavy burden is placed on the ability of the system to explain what it is doing and why.
منابع مشابه
Autonomic Computing for B2C E-Commerce Applications
Ever increasing complexity, higher demand for proactiveness, and high speeds of innovation resulting from heavy competition, demand the adoption of more intelligent systems, which are capable of producing optimal results, in all fields. B2C E-Commerce applications are no different. The major challenge in transitioning a brick and mortar business to an online environment is to provide the same u...
متن کاملMaking DB2Products Self-Managing: Strategies and Experiences
This paper evaluates the impact of the DB2 Autonomic Computing project at the IBM Toronto Software Lab, Almaden Research Center, and Watson Research Center. It describes the key ideas behind the many self-managing features added to the IBM R ©DB2 R ©for Linux R ©, UNIX R ©, and Windows R ©products, and evaluates the degree to which these features have been accepted by the DB2 user community. We...
متن کاملAutonomic personal computing
Autonomic personal computing is personal computing on autonomic computing platforms. Its goals combine those of personal computing with those of autonomic computing. The challenge of personal autonomic computing is to simplify and enhance the end-user experience, delighting the user by anticipating his or her needs in the face of a complex, dynamic, and uncertain environment. In this paper we i...
متن کاملLetter from the Editor - in - Chief The IEEE Technical Committee on Data Engineering
This paper evaluates the impact of the DB2 Autonomic Computing project at the IBM Toronto Software Lab, Almaden Research Center, and Watson Research Center. It describes the key ideas behind the many self-managing features added to the IBM R ©DB2 R ©for Linux R ©, UNIX R ©, and Windows R ©products, and evaluates the degree to which these features have been accepted by the DB2 user community. We...
متن کاملAn Autonomic Service Oriented Architecture in Computational Engineering Framework
Service Oriented Architecture (SOA) technology enables composition of large and complex computational units out of the available atomic services. Implementation of SOA brings about challenges which include service discovery, service interaction, service composition, robustness, quality of service, security, etc. These challenges are mainly due to the dynamic nature of SOA. SOAmay often need to 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
- IBM Systems Journal
دوره 42 شماره
صفحات -
تاریخ انتشار 2003